What does a MAP Sensor for 2000 dodge look like?

2000 Dodge Neon MAP Sensor

The MAP (manifold absolute pressure) sensor for a 2000 Dodge Neon is a small, round sensor that is located on the intake manifold. It is used to measure the pressure of the air entering the engine. The MAP sensor is important for proper engine operation, as it helps the engine computer to adjust the fuel mixture and timing.

Here is a more detailed description of the MAP sensor for a 2000 Dodge Neon:

* Location: The MAP sensor is located on the intake manifold, near the throttle body. It is usually held in place by two screws.

* Appearance: The MAP sensor is a small, round sensor that is made of plastic or metal. It has a black or gray connector that plugs into the wiring harness.

* Function: The MAP sensor measures the pressure of the air entering the engine. This information is used by the engine computer to adjust the fuel mixture and timing. The MAP sensor also helps to prevent the engine from running too lean or too rich.

If the MAP sensor is not working properly, it can cause the engine to run rough or stall. It can also lead to a loss of power and fuel economy. If you suspect that your MAP sensor is not working properly, you should have it tested by a qualified mechanic.

Here are some tips for diagnosing a faulty MAP sensor:

* Check the vacuum hose: The MAP sensor is connected to the intake manifold by a vacuum hose. If the vacuum hose is cracked or damaged, it can cause the MAP sensor to read incorrectly.

* Check the electrical connection: The MAP sensor is also connected to the engine computer by an electrical connector. If the electrical connection is loose or damaged, it can cause the MAP sensor to read incorrectly.

* Test the MAP sensor: If you suspect that the MAP sensor is not working properly, you can test it by using a multimeter. There are several online resources that can show you how to test a MAP sensor.

If you are not comfortable testing the MAP sensor yourself, you should have it tested by a qualified mechanic.
